The ADS8327IBRSARG4 operates based on the successive approximation register (SAR) architecture. It samples the analog input voltage and converts it into a digital representation using a binary search algorithm. The internal circuitry compares the input voltage against a reference voltage and determines the digital code that represents the input value.

Q: What is the ADS8327IBRSARG4? A: The ADS8327IBRSARG4 is a high-performance, 16-bit analog-to-digital converter (ADC) designed for precision measurement applications.
Q: What is the input voltage range of the ADS8327IBRSARG4? A: The ADS8327IBRSARG4 has a differential input voltage range of ±VREF and a single-ended input voltage range of 0 to VREF.
Q: What is the maximum sampling rate of the ADS8327IBRSARG4? A: The ADS8327IBRSARG4 has a maximum sampling rate of 500 kilosamples per second (ksps).
Q: What is the resolution of the ADS8327IBRSARG4? A: The ADS8327IBRSARG4 has a resolution of 16 bits, providing excellent accuracy and precision in measurements.
Q: What is the power supply voltage range for the ADS8327IBRSARG4? A: The ADS8327IBRSARG4 operates with a power supply voltage range of 2.7V to 5.5V.
